#ec128c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ec128c is composed of 92.5% red, 7.1%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.4% magenta, 40.7%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 326.4 degrees, a saturation of 85.8% and a lightness of 49.8%. #ec128c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ff24ff with #d90019. Closest websafe color is: #ff0099.

#ec128c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ec128c has RGB values of R:236, G:18,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.41,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15471244.

Hex triplet ec128c #ec128c
RGB Decimal 236, 18, 140 rgb(236,18,140)
RGB Percent 92.5, 7.1, 54.9 rgb(92.5%,7.1%,54.9%)
CMYK 0, 92, 41, 7
HSL 326.4°, 85.8, 49.8 hsl(326.4,85.8%,49.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 326.4°, 92.4, 92.5
Web Safe ff0099 #ff0099
CIE-LAB 52.021, 80.067, -7.779
XYZ 39.543, 20.163, 26.619
xyY 0.458, 0.234, 20.163
CIE-LCH 52.021, 80.444, 354.451
CIE-LUV 52.021, 119.775, -25.807
Hunter-Lab 44.903, 78.61, -3.715
Binary 11101100, 00010010, 10001100

Shades and Tints of #ec128c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#11010a is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#ec128c is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#616161 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#7d516a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#6a80c0 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#8e7f83 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#e84244 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#9958ad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b05786 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#e9305e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
